2026 TCS New York City Marathon drawing day sees record 240,000+ applicants for 50th anniversary race
Today is Drawing Day for the 2026 TCS New York City Marathon, and thousands of runners are waiting to see if they get selected. The drawing decides who gets a spot in the race if they applied without guaranteed entry, according to NBC New York. This year is historic because more than 240,000 people applied, which is the highest ever, according to New York Road Runners (NYRR). Applications came from over 160 countries, showing the marathon is loved worldwide.

The demand has skyrocketed, said NYRR, stating that it will be 20 percent higher than 2025, and only about 1% of applicants will be accepted. That means it is extremely competitive. The 2026 race will take place on Sunday, November 1. Last year’s marathon (2025) became the largest marathon in the world, with 59,226 finishers. The event is organized by New York Road Runners, a nonprofit that hosts 60 races every year, including this marathon. The 2026 race is extra special because it marks the 50th anniversary of the five-borough course.The five-borough course was first run in 1976 to celebrate America’s Bicentennial and to uplift the city. The marathon started in 1970 inside Central Park with just 55 finishers. Today, it brings nearly 60,000 runners and more than two million spectators.


How to know if you got in

If your credit card is charged the full race fee, that means you are accepted, according to NYRR. The charge may appear before you receive the email. All applicants will get an email by the end of the day, whether accepted or not. You can also check your NYRR account, where your status will say “Accepted” if you got in. If you did not get selected in the general drawing, you are automatically entered into a second-chance drawing.

Other ways to get entry

Some runners already got guaranteed entries through programs like:
  • NYRR 9+1 Program
  • NYRR Virtual Racing
  • Time Qualifiers
  • NYRR Philanthropic Membership
  • Streakers (15+ marathon finishes)
For non-NYRR time qualifiers, only the top 10% were accepted, and runners had to be 22 minutes and 52 seconds faster than the standard time.

Official charity partner program

Runners can enter by raising money through the Official Charity Partner Program. This year, the program expanded to 670+ charities, the most ever. NYRR aims to raise over $100 million for charities in 2026. Around 60% of partner charities are based in New York City.

In 2025, a record $80 million was raised for charities, including $38.4 million for NYC-based charities, according to NYRR. Since 2006, the charity program has raised nearly $700 million.

Across the Boroughs Sweepstakes

Starting March 5, runners who did not get in can enter the Across the Boroughs Marathon Sweepstakes. Two grand prize winners will get free entry to the marathon and all six NYRR Five-Borough Series races. Ten runner-up winners will get free marathon entry. Sweepstakes entries close March 19, and winners will be announced by March 26.

The Six Five-Borough Series races include:

  • RBC Brooklyn Half
  • Citizens Queens 10K
  • New Balance Bronx 10 Mile
  • NYRR Staten Island Half
  • NYRR Manhattan 10K
  • United Airlines NYC Half


Member-Only Second Chance

Around 24,000 eligible NYRR members who didn’t get selected are automatically entered into a Member-Only Second-Chance Drawing. Up to 2% of those members will be accepted. Members will be notified by email before the end of the day.
ADVERTISEMENT

International runners

International runners can book through official International Tour Operators (ITOs). There are 100+ approved tour operators in 50 countries, according to NYRR. These packages include guaranteed race entry and travel support.

NYRR team for climate

Runners can also apply through NYRR Team for Climate. This program supports sustainability and helps reduce the race’s carbon footprint. Applications open in April during Earth Month. Since launching in 2024, the program has raised over $1.6 million, including $640,000+ in 2025.
